Abstract
Provided herein are 6-carboxylic acids of benzimidazoles and 4-aza-, 5-aza-, 7-aza- and 4,7-diaza-benzimidazoles as GLP-1R agonists, processes to make said compounds, and methods comprising administering said compounds to a mammal in need thereof.

23. A pharmaceutical composition comprising the compound of Formula I of claim 1 , or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, and a pharmaceutically acceptable excipient.
24. A pharmaceutical composition comprising the compound of claim 17 , or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, and a pharmaceutically acceptable excipient.
25. A method of treating cardiometabolic diseases comprising administering to a mammal in need of such treatment a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of claim 1 , or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, wherein the disease is T2DM, pre-diabetes, NASH, or cardiovascular disease.
